Stitch up, a game of many names, though I know it as "Sh* head"Reccomended players 2-5Each player is dealt 3 cards face down, and then 6 more cards they can see. The basic objective is to get rid of all your cards, and play goes like this:Players choose 3 cards to put on top of their face down 3, and the player going first wi... More..
